FC Edmonton Open Spring Campaign Against NASL Champions

December 19, 2013 - North American Soccer League (NASL)
FC Edmonton News Release


EDMONTON, AB (December 19, 2013) - FC Edmonton and the North American Soccer League (NASL) announce today the release of the Spring Schedule for the 2014 NASL season.

With the addition of Ottawa Fury FC and the Indy Eleven to the league, the NASL will play a nine-game schedule in the spring of 2014. FCE's first home game will take place on April 19, 2014 against last season's Soccer Bowl Champions the New York Cosmos.

"It's always a special time when you get to play the Cosmos," said FCE head coach Colin Miller. "We are looking forward to a big home crowd. Last season, fans were treated to two great matches and we're hoping for another great set of matches this season."

The Eddies following home games will be against the Fort Lauderdale Strikers, Atlanta Silverbacks and Carolina RailHawks to wrap up the Spring Season. The majority of FC Edmonton's home games in the Spring Season will take place on Saturday's with the exception of the last game, which will take place on a Sunday, times are yet to be determined. Please note that all match dates and times are all subject to change.

"After listening to many of our fans and soccer enthusiasts, we will now be playing three of our first four home matches in 2014 on Saturdays," said FC Edmonton general manager Rod Proudfoot. "The Club is working very diligently on improving the match experience, and we fully expect to sell out a number of games this season."

FC Edmonton is one of five teams that will have four games at home in the spring to pave the way to the Soccer Bowl for 2014. The shortened nine-week spring campaign will run through June 8, to allow for a mid-season break to align with the FIFA World Cup. The winner of the first half of the NASL season will qualify for and earn the right to host NASL Soccer Bowl 2014.

"We're playing an unbalanced schedule. It's as simple as that," said Proudfoot. "There are factors that contributed to the decision for some teams to have four home games from stadium conflicts to weather conditions. The fact of the matter is, some teams have to play four home games, and we head into our schedule with the intent of a successful season."

The remaining games in the Spring Season will take place on the road and will feature games against Minnesota, Indianapolis, San Antonio, Ottawa and Carolina. The season opener for the Eddies will take place on April 12, 2014 in St. Petersburg against the Tampa Bay Rowdies.

The 2014 Spring Schedule is as follows:

Saturday April 12, 2014 - @ Tampa Bay Rowdies (5:30 p.m. MT)

Saturday April 19, 2014 - vs New York Cosmos (TBA)

Saturday April 26, 2014 - @ Minnesota United FC (TBA)

Saturday May 3, 2014 - vs Fort Lauderdale Strikers (TBA)

Saturday May 10, 2014 - @ Indy Eleven (5:30 p.m. MT)

Saturday May 17, 2014 - @ San Antonio Scorpions (TBA)

Saturday May 24, 2014 - vs Atlanta Silverbacks 9TBA)

Saturday May 31, 2014 - @ Ottawa Fury FC (TBA)

Sunday June 8, 2014 - vs Carolina RailHawks (2:00 p.m. MT)

*All dates and times are subject to change
